A wonderful day on the water was had by all, for the First Annual "Sails Up for Downs Syndrome" (SUDS) Charity Boat Ride. This was the initial idea of Hans Witten the Commodore of the American Legion Yacht Club. Together he and Josef Davydovits, Commodore of SeaGate Yacht Club & his wife Kim have been planning this first event, along with the leadership of Downs Syndrome Association of Orange County (DSAOC). We appreciate the willingness and generosity of the 3 Captains who provided their boats for the day; Captain Dennis Huffman of Bad Habit, Captain Robin Clark of Fintastic, & Captain Richard Knappes of Lucky Change. We had Commodore Witten along with his Fleet Capt. Anne Borren, Treasurer Marco Monters & Director Steve Sawdon in attendance as well as Commodore of SeaGate Yacht Club, Josef Davydovits and his wife Kim. The children ranged in age from 5-11 years of age and along with their families. There were 50+ for the 3 hour cruise inside Huntington Harbour Channels. We were very fortunate to have Sgt. J.Hollenback, Station Commander of the Harbour Patrol, arrange a fantastic water and siren display at the beginning of our cruise. All the boats circled around and were able to watch the spectacle and the kids were all very excited and amazed to see this. For most of these children this was there first time on a boat, so this was a monumental day for all. We hope to have one or more a year sponsored boat rides, alternating between Newport Beach and ourselves in Huntington Harbour. L-R: Jean Clark, Chrissy Bates, Ray Nagele, Jan Nagele, Robin Clark & Dan Bates This year s annual SeaGate raft up reverted back to a raft up only in the Lido basin anchorage area. There was a total of twelve boats. Fin-Tastic and Yorkshire Rose arrived first on Thursday morning to await the arrival of the fleet. We had our core anchor boaters plus some very welcome new additions. Thank you so much to Robin Clark, Dean Knupp and others for making sure everyone anchored safely. Also, many thanks to co-hosts Robin and Jean Clark for being such great cocktail hosts on the Friday evening, even though Jean had just had surgery and had her arm in a cast. We had fun with a vodka tasting contest organized by cohosts Dan (the man) and Chrissy Bates. Sherri Ferns won the vodka tasting. Then on to Saturday where the grand finale was at Woody s Wharf for dinner and awards. We very much enjoyed welcoming Nancy Sandvig and Russ Farber to their first SGYC event. They very recently moved into SeaGate and joined the Yacht club right away. Finally, many thanks to all our members boats who made this event wonderful. Fin-Tastic (Clark), Yorkshire Rose (Nagele), Cape Hatt R Us (Sambria), RO lll (D Angelo), La Fortuna ll (Aime), Cheryl Ann (Arndt), Knot on Call (Ferns), Sea-Renity (Haas), Kathleen (Lee), Chris Sea Gil (Morris), Senza Bambini (Giali/ Ricketts) ), Snug (Surridge) and to all our club members who drove down to Newport Beach. Sadly we missed Gimme 5 (Courtway) who always ferried so many of us back and forth. Speedy recovery Mike. Of course, we cannot forget our great Port Captains Rob and Cindy Allen for always taking care of us and Ray and Jan Nagele for co-hosting the event. It was a fun time and we look forward to many more.
